Transaction 860ffc6918eb4a412a5f88c5eebf905a85504e508d78382f612cf66564fa84c9
1 Input
1 Output
-
860ffc6918eb4a412a5f88c5eebf905a85504e508d78382f612cf66564fa84c9:0
- value
- 765254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f66633f571a4b1a8202bfc4d8a9908447eb1b41 OP_EQUAL
- address
- 34Z3XWdDzsXc4H5Rgr76XhfsNQcT88UQZs